Abstract

The utility model mainly discloses a drain pipe cyclone which comprises a vertical pipe and a horizontal pipe, wherein the horizontal pipe is spirally jointed with the outer wall of the vertical pipe and is communicated with the vertical pipe; a flow guiding plate protruding upwards is arranged on the lower edge of the inner part of a connection part of the horizontal pipe and the vertical pipe. The waterflow in the horizontal pipe is close to the wall of the horizontal pipe and is smoothly drained donwards from the horizontal pipe, without being directly poured in the vertical pipe from the horizontal pipe, so that the nappe with the waterflow in the vertical pipe is eliminated, the air column effect of a single vertical pipe is stabler, and the drain is smoother.

Description

A kind of gutter cyclone
Technical field
The utility model relates to the construction drainage technical field, and is special relevant with a kind of single-stack drain system.
Background technology
Single standpipe is used very general in present highrise building, the drainage system of comparing tradition increase ventilating pipe has the saving architectural space, saves the gutter cost, easy construction, therefore the characteristics such as quiet become the high layer sewerage system of present main flow with the single standpipe of the special draining of cyclone.Existing cyclone much all adopts the mode of side spiral water inlet, when lateral inflow, when laterally flowing water pours standpipe, the impact dynamics is larger, can form larger overflow with standpipe direction current, destroy the intermediate air post, and the sound that the flowing water impact is sent is larger.Therefore in the design of eddy flow stream device, the place of connecting is improved to the adherent spiral of side pipe and imports, and current are through the helical structure of side pipe, form the convolution shape, changed water (flow) direction, can slow down thus the overflow that produces with the standpipe current, the assurance inner air tube is unobstructed, reduces simultaneously noise.
But the lateral inflow of this helicoidal structure, its side pipe and straight tube junction, wall communicates within it, and side pipe is equivalent to the spiral cell body that is provided with on the standpipe inwall, when current reach certain speed and certain flow, just can be fitted in convolution whereabouts water inlet in the spiral cell body.In case current are less, when the impact dynamics is inadequate, current are not enough to form convolution and fall in the spiral cell body, but directly flow into the standpipe from the junction, although therefore the impact dynamics is little under the weep state, but the current noise is fairly obvious, and the inventor designs a kind of gutter cyclone thus, and this case produces thus.
The utility model content
Main purpose of the present utility model provides a kind of gutter cyclone, eliminates the noise that weep produces when being used for side spiral water inlet.
In order to achieve the above object, the utility model is achieved through the following technical solutions:
A kind of gutter cyclone comprises standpipe and transverse tube, and transverse tube spiral applying standing tube outer wall is communicated with standpipe, has the flow deflector to upper process in inner lower edge, the junction of transverse tube and standpipe.
Described flow deflector is to arrange along the transverse tube spiral.
Described flow deflector is for reducing highly successively from top to down.
The starting altitude of described flow deflector is 2~3cm.
After adopting such scheme, the utlity model has many beneficial effects:
In the utility model therein transverse tube inwall lower edge bossed flow deflector is set, therefore, when weep is laterally intake, although flow velocity is little, but by the guiding of flow deflector, can be smoothly with current adherent drainage and descending from the transverse tube of spiral, and can directly not pour into to standpipe from transverse tube, thereby eliminated the noise of current, further slowed down the pressure that the standpipe draining is born.

The specific embodiment
By reference to the accompanying drawings, preferred embodiment is described in further details to the utility model.
A kind of gutter cyclone, the parts that relate generally to comprise standpipe 1 and transverse tube 2, and standpipe 1 is the hollow body that is communicated with up and down, is connected with transverse tube 2 at its sidewall.
Transverse tube 2 applying standpipe walls, 1/4 spiral that coils its body circumference connects.Inner lower edge has the flow deflector 3 to upper process in the junction of transverse tube 2 and standpipe 1.Flow deflector 3 is along transverse tube 2 junction spirals and lower the setting, and, from original position, reduce highly successively from top to down at the height of flow deflector 3, be traditionally arranged to be 2~3cm at starting altitude, this highly neither affects drainage speed, also can guarantee the guiding of current.
When the utility model uses, the up and down two ends of standpipe 1 are connected on the vertical pipeline of drainage system, transverse tube 2 connects on the horizontal pipeline of drainage system, when the current in the horizontal pipeline are incorporated into standpipe 1 by transverse tube 2, circle round successively and descend along the spiral caliber of transverse tube 2 in inside, current are subject to stopping of flow deflector 3 simultaneously, prevent from directly being circulated in the standpipe 1 from transverse tube 2, guarantee the adherent convolution of current, further abate the noise.
